+MCP Toolbox for Databases is an open source Model Context Protocol (MCP) server that connects your AI agents, IDEs, and applications directly to your enterprise databases.
+
+
+
+
+
+It serves a **dual purpose**:
+1. **Ready-to-use MCP Server (Build-Time):** Instantly connect Gemini CLI, Google Antigravity, Claude Code, Codex, or other MCP clients to your databases using our *prebuilt generic tools*. Talk to your data, explore schemas, and generate code without writing boilerplate.
+2. **Custom Tools Framework (Run-Time):** A robust framework to build specialized, highly secure AI tools for your production agents. Define structured queries, semantic search, and NL2SQL capabilities safely and easily.

+## Why MCP Toolbox?
+
+- **Out-of-the-Box Database Access:** Prebuilt generic tools for instant data exploration (e.g., `list_tables`, `execute_sql`) directly from your IDE or CLI.
+- **Custom Tools Framework:** Build production-ready tools with your own predefined logic, ensuring safety through Restricted Access, Structured Queries, and Semantic Search.
+- **Simplified Development:** Integrate tools into your Agent Development Kit (ADK), LangChain, LlamaIndex, or custom agents in less than 10 lines of code.
+- **Better Performance:** Handles connection pooling, integrated auth (IAM), and end-to-end observability (OpenTelemetry) out of the box.
+- **Enhanced Security**: Integrated authentication for more secure access to your data.
+- **End-to-end Observability**: Out of the box metrics and tracing with built-in support for OpenTelemetry.

+## Quick Start: Prebuilt Tools
+
+Stop context-switching and let your AI assistant become a true co-developer. By connecting your IDE to your databases with MCP Toolbox, you can query your data in plain English, automate schema discovery and management, and generate database-aware code.
+
+You can use the Toolbox in any MCP-compatible IDE or client (e.g., Gemini CLI, Google Antigravity, Claude Code, Codex, etc.) by configuring the MCP server.
+
+**Prebuilt tools are also conveniently available via the [Google Antigravity MCP Store](https://antigravity.google/docs/mcp) with a simple click-to-install experience.**
+
+1. Add the following to your client's MCP configuration file (usually `mcp.json` or `claude_desktop_config.json`):
+
+ ```json
+ {
+ "mcpServers": {
+ "toolbox-postgres": {
+ "command": "npx",
+ "args": [
+ "-y",
+ "@toolbox-sdk/server",
+ "--prebuilt=postgres",
+ "--stdio"
+ ]
+ }
+ }
+ }
+ ```
+
+2. Set the appropriate environment variables to connect, see the [Prebuilt Tools Reference](https://mcp-toolbox.dev/documentation/configuration/prebuilt-configs/).
+
+When you run Toolbox with a `--prebuilt=` flag, you instantly get access to standard tools to interact with that database. You can also specify a specific toolset using the `--prebuilt=/` syntax (e.g., `--prebuilt=postgres/data` to only load SQL tools).
+
+Supported databases currently include:
+- **Google Cloud:** AlloyDB, BigQuery, Cloud SQL (PostgreSQL, MySQL, SQL Server), Spanner, Firestore, Knowledge Catalog (formerly known as Dataplex).
+- **Other Databases:** PostgreSQL, MySQL, [MariaDB](https://mcp-toolbox.dev/integrations/mariadb/source/), SQL Server, Oracle, MongoDB, Redis, Elasticsearch, CockroachDB, ClickHouse, Couchbase, Neo4j, Snowflake, Trino, and more.
+
+For a full list of available tools and their capabilities across all supported databases, see the [Prebuilt Tools Reference](https://mcp-toolbox.dev/documentation/configuration/prebuilt-configs/).

+## Quick Start: Custom Tools
+
+Toolbox can also be used as a framework for customized tools.
+The primary way to configure Toolbox is through the `tools.yaml` file. If you
+have multiple files, you can tell Toolbox which to load with the `--config
+tools.yaml` flag.
+
+You can find more detailed reference documentation to all resource types in the
+[Resources](https://mcp-toolbox.dev/documentation/configuration/).
+
+### Sources
+
+The `sources` section of your `tools.yaml` defines what data sources your
+Toolbox should have access to. Most tools will have at least one source to
+execute against.
+
+```yaml
+kind: source
+name: my-pg-source
+type: postgres
+host: 127.0.0.1
+port: 5432
+database: toolbox_db
+user: toolbox_user
+password: my-password
+```
+
+For more details on configuring different types of sources, see the
+[Sources](https://mcp-toolbox.dev/documentation/configuration/sources/).
+
+### Tools
+
+The `tools` section of a `tools.yaml` define the actions an agent can take: what
+type of tool it is, which source(s) it affects, what parameters it uses, etc.
+
+```yaml
+kind: tool
+name: search-hotels-by-name
+type: postgres-sql
+source: my-pg-source
+description: Search for hotels based on name.
+parameters:
+ - name: name
+ type: string
+ description: The name of the hotel.
+statement: SELECT * FROM hotels WHERE name ILIKE '%' || $1 || '%';
+```
+
+For more details on configuring different types of tools, see the
+[Tools](https://mcp-toolbox.dev/documentation/configuration/tools/).
+
+### Toolsets
+
+The `toolsets` section of your `tools.yaml` allows you to define groups of tools
+that you want to be able to load together. This can be useful for defining
+different groups based on agent or application.
+
+```yaml
+kind: toolset
+name: my_first_toolset
+tools:
+ - my_first_tool
+ - my_second_tool
+---
+kind: toolset
+name: my_second_toolset
+tools:
+ - my_second_tool
+ - my_third_tool
+```
+
+### Prompts
+
+The `prompts` section of a `tools.yaml` defines prompts that can be used for
+interactions with LLMs.
+
+```yaml
+kind: prompt
+name: code_review
+description: "Asks the LLM to analyze code quality and suggest improvements."
+messages:
+ - content: >
+ Please review the following code for quality, correctness,
+ and potential improvements: \n\n{{.code}}
+arguments:
+ - name: "code"
+ description: "The code to review"
+```
+
+For more details on configuring prompts, see the
+[Prompts](https://mcp-toolbox.dev/documentation/configuration/prompts/).

+### Run Toolbox
+
+[Configure](#quick-start-custom-tools) a `tools.yaml` to define your tools, and then
+execute `toolbox` to start the server:
+
+
+Binary
+
+To run Toolbox from binary:
+
+```sh
+./toolbox --config "tools.yaml"
+```
+
+> ⓘ Note
+> Toolbox enables dynamic reloading by default. To disable, use the
+> `--disable-reload` flag.
+
+
+
+
+
+Container image
+
+To run the server after pulling the [container image](#install-toolbox):
+
+```sh
+export VERSION=0.24.0 # Use the version you pulled
+docker run -p 5000:5000 \
+-v $(pwd)/tools.yaml:/app/tools.yaml \
+us-central1-docker.pkg.dev/database-toolbox/toolbox/toolbox:$VERSION \
+--config "/app/tools.yaml"
+```
+
+> ⓘ Note
+> The `-v` flag mounts your local `tools.yaml` into the container, and `-p` maps
+> the container's port `5000` to your host's port `5000`.
+
+
+
+
+
+Source
+
+To run the server directly from source, navigate to the project root directory
+and run:
+
+```sh
+go run .
+```
+
+> ⓘ Note
+> This command runs the project from source, and is more suitable for development
+> and testing. It does **not** compile a binary into your `$GOPATH`. If you want
+> to compile a binary instead, refer the [Developer
+> Documentation](./DEVELOPER.md#building-the-binary).
+
+
+
+
+
+Homebrew
+
+If you installed Toolbox using [Homebrew](https://brew.sh/), the `toolbox`
+binary is available in your system path. You can start the server with the same
+command:
+
+```sh
+toolbox --config "tools.yaml"
+```

+## Connect to Toolbox
+
+Once your Toolbox server is up and running, you can load tools into your MCP-compatible client or
+application.
+
+### MCP Client
+
+Add the following configuration to your MCP client configuration:
+
+```json
+{
+ "mcpServers": {
+ "toolbox": {
+ "type": "http",
+ "url": "http://127.0.0.1:5000/mcp",
+ }
+ }
+}
+```
+
+If you would like to connect to a specific toolset, replace url with "http://127.0.0.1:5000/mcp/{toolset_name}".

+## Additional Features
+
+### Test tools with the Toolbox UI
+
+To launch Toolbox's interactive UI, use the `--ui` flag. This allows you to test
+tools and toolsets with features such as authorized parameters. To learn more,
+visit [Toolbox UI](https://mcp-toolbox.dev/documentation/configuration/toolbox-ui/).
+
+```sh
+./toolbox --ui
+```
+
+### Telemetry
+
+Toolbox emits traces and metrics via OpenTelemetry. Use `--telemetry-otlp=`
+to export to any OTLP-compatible backend like Google Cloud Monitoring, Agnost AI, or
+others. See the [telemetry docs](https://mcp-toolbox.dev/documentation/monitoring/export_telemetry/) for details.
+
+### Generate Agent Skills
+
+The `skills-generate` command allows you to convert a **toolset** into an **Agent Skill** compatible with the [Agent Skill specification](https://agentskills.io/specification). This is useful for distributing tools as portable skill packages.
+
+```bash
+toolbox --config tools.yaml skills-generate \
+ --name "my-skill" \
+ --toolset "my_toolset" \
+ --description "A skill containing multiple tools"
+```
+
+Once generated, you can install the skill into the Gemini CLI:
+
+```bash
+gemini skills install ./skills/my-skill
+```
+
+For more details, see the [Generate Agent Skills guide](https://mcp-toolbox.dev/documentation/configuration/skills/).

+## Versioning
+
+MCP Toolbox for Databases follows [Semantic Versioning](https://semver.org/).
+
+The Public API includes the Toolbox Server (CLI, configuration manifests, and pre-built toolsets) and the Client SDKs.
+
+- **Major versions** are incremented for breaking changes, such as incompatible CLI or manifest changes.
+- **Minor versions** are incremented for new features, including modifications to pre-built toolsets or beta features.
+- **Patch versions** are incremented for backward-compatible bug fixes.
+
+For more details, see our [Full Versioning Policy](https://mcp-toolbox.dev/reference/versioning/).
